White Clay Creek State Park

White Clay Creek State Park

Prepare to be captivated by the sheer natural beauty and expansive recreational opportunities awaiting you at this sprawling state park, a true gem straddling the Delaware-Pennsylvania border. This isn’t just a park; it’s a vibrant ecosystem offering something for every outdoor enthusiast. You can spend hours traversing its extensive network of hiking and biking trails, which range from easy strolls along the creek to more challenging ascents with rewarding scenic overlooks.

The tranquil White Clay Creek itself is a designated National Wild and Scenic River, perfect for fishing or simply enjoying the soothing sounds of flowing water. Picnicking areas abound, providing perfect spots for a family lunch amidst nature. Birdwatchers will be delighted by the diverse avian population, while photographers will find endless inspiration in the changing seasons. Whether you’re seeking an invigorating workout, a peaceful escape, or a fun day out with the family, the park provides an idyllic backdrop for reconnecting with the natural world.

Grotto Pizza

Grotto Pizza

Satisfy your pizza cravings with a taste of this iconic East Coast establishment, a staple for many Delawareans. This isn’t just another pizza place; it’s a regional favorite with a distinct style that evokes memories of beach boardwalks and casual family meals. When you order from here, you’ll experience their unique “swirl” of sauce on top of the cheese, a signature touch that sets their pies apart.

The menu extends beyond classic pizzas to include a variety of subs, salads, and pasta dishes, ensuring there’s something to please everyone in your group. It’s a perfect casual dining option for families with kids, groups of friends, or anyone looking for a comforting and familiar meal. The atmosphere is typically lively and family-friendly, making it an easy choice for a relaxed lunch or dinner. You’ll quickly understand why this pizza has such a loyal following in the region.
